How do dental implant costs in Turkey compare to UK prices?

The cost disparity between UK and Turkish dental implant procedures remains substantial in 2025. UK dental implant costs typically range from £1,500 to £3,000 per implant, depending on the complexity of the case and the clinic’s location. In contrast, Turkish dental clinics often offer single implant procedures for £400 to £800, representing savings of up to 70% compared to UK prices.

Several factors contribute to these price differences, including lower operational costs, favourable exchange rates, and government incentives for medical tourism in Turkey. However, patients must consider additional expenses such as travel, accommodation, and potential follow-up visits when calculating the total cost of treatment abroad.

What is the average cost of full mouth dental implants in Turkey?

Full mouth dental implant procedures in Turkey typically cost between £3,000 and £6,000, significantly less than the £15,000 to £30,000 charged by UK clinics. This dramatic difference has made Turkey an attractive option for patients requiring extensive dental work. Turkish clinics often package treatments to include accommodation and transfers, making the overall experience more convenient for international patients.

The lower costs don’t necessarily indicate inferior quality, as many Turkish dental facilities invest heavily in modern equipment and internationally trained staff. However, patients should research clinics thoroughly and verify credentials before committing to treatment abroad.

What should you know about all-on-4 implant pricing in the UK?

All-on-4 implant procedures in the UK range from £8,000 to £15,000 per arch, making them a significant investment for patients. This technique involves placing four strategically positioned implants to support a full arch of teeth, offering a more affordable alternative to individual implants for each missing tooth.

UK clinics often provide comprehensive aftercare packages, including regular check-ups and maintenance services. The higher cost reflects not only the procedure itself but also the ongoing support and warranty coverage that many UK practices offer their patients.

How to choose between clinics in the UK and Turkey safely

Selecting the right clinic requires careful evaluation of multiple factors beyond cost. UK patients should verify that Turkish clinics hold international accreditations and employ qualified dental professionals. Researching patient reviews, requesting detailed treatment plans, and confirming warranty terms are essential steps in the decision-making process.

For UK treatment, patients should ensure their chosen provider is registered with the General Dental Council and offers transparent pricing structures. Many UK clinics provide financing options to make treatment more accessible, which may offset some of the cost advantages of overseas treatment.

Communication is crucial when considering international treatment. Patients should ensure they can effectively communicate with their chosen provider and understand all aspects of their treatment plan. Additionally, considering the logistics of follow-up care and potential complications is essential when weighing options between domestic and international providers.
